Transaction 86688986333839f14338a9b27244149abc9ca5fc4c069590d368682ab6e1f2ae
1 Input
1 Output
-
86688986333839f14338a9b27244149abc9ca5fc4c069590d368682ab6e1f2ae:0
- value
- 4521
- script pubkey
- OP_0 OP_PUSHBYTES_20 f6a086698965d98c33892ac967f7850707ccfa87
- address
- bc1q76sgv6vfvhvccvuf9tyk0au9qurue7584vj994